Factorrelated
Factorrelated is a term used to describe properties, results, or methods that pertain to factors of integers or to the factorization process. In number theory and related fields, factorrelated topics examine how prime factors, divisors, and factorization influence arithmetic structure, algorithmic performance, and cryptographic relevance. The term is not standard in major references but is sometimes used informally to group ideas that hinge on the prime decomposition of numbers.
